"I want to focus on my club [career] now," confirmed Robben post-game. "It's a good time to pass the torch to the next generation.

"It was special and it was difficult. But it was not about me. But if you know in advance that it may be the last one, then that's very special," said Robben.

"I wanted to show you what I can do. That has been done, I was well in the game. That's how I am, as I've always tried to show with the Dutch team.

"I've been thinking about it for a long time. I'm very proud and honoured at my six final tournaments. The most beautiful moments to me are the 2010 and 2014 World Championships, in which we were really a close team and a close group.

"But there are many beautiful moments, fourteen years is a long time. "

Arjen Robben announces international retirement after Holland fail to secure World Cup play-off berth
